No this USB flash drive doesn’t come in the shape of some Panda nor does it just store 8GB of data. Instead it doubles as a voice recorder as well, and is able to store up to 160 hours of audio. Throw that old voice recorder away because with this double threat you don’t need it anymore. You can discreetly place it anywhere on a desk when in a meeting or at a seminar and have everything you’ll need recorded on the sly. Send files to your email if you need to free up space and the rechargable battery lasts up to 4 hours. The 8GB USB Voice Recorder retails for $99.95 from Brickhouse Security and a more affordable 2GB verison for $49.99 is available as well.
